Selection guide

How buyers define a bedding program

Send as much of this information as possible. Missing details can be resolved with material options and samples.

Warmth and climate

Fill weight, down content and construction are matched to the season, room temperature and regional buying expectation.

Support and comfort

Pillow height, fill blend and recovery should be selected by sleep preference, room type or retail positioning.

Shell and presentation

Cotton weight, weave, finish, color and stitching define hand feel, down containment and bed appearance.

Program and packing

Sizes, labels, care information, retail bags, compression packing and cartons are planned with the product range.

Buying FAQ

Before you request bedding samples

Can one order combine different down bedding products?

Yes. Duvets, pillows, toppers and hotel sets can be planned as one specification sheet so sizes, fills, labels and packing stay coordinated.

What is the best way to compare product options?

Confirm the target market and application first, then compare samples by fill, shell, construction, weight, recovery and finishing.
